Output 52eea3a53817d23d3a378b4cd4e4be58c733d1739aaf4fbfb8c4e767bca86804:0

value
73000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c007713507e8e934def05b66d8ad3318e0941e OP_EQUAL
address
3NBPKvkVoj3TkqimXoeg5gRwqmtsQJ7aoS
transaction
52eea3a53817d23d3a378b4cd4e4be58c733d1739aaf4fbfb8c4e767bca86804
confirmations
157311
spent
true